HELP Needed With Setting Up A Home Network by Conner44: 12:20am On Aug 08, 2016
hello members and especially networking gurus. I am about to purchase some networking devices to help keep all my computers connected in my home. I have been on Amazon looking for the items but due to the number of devices to choose from i am left confused ( i am a novice in these things) but i beieve that if i can purchase the right equipments i need then i can set them up with the aid of google no problem.

I plan to buy

1. a good stable ROUTER (with port forwarding capabilities) that has at least 3 ETHERNET ports to allow internet connection to other devices via WIFI and ETHERNET ports

2. a good MODEM ( dial-up with LTE capability) so that i can subscribe for an internet plan with any of our ISP's and then connect this same modem to the router either via USB or WIFI.

3. i plan to connect my PRINTER and COMPUTER to the ROUTER via ETHERNET cable and also my mobile phones to the router via WIFI.

Please i need someone to recommend a good ROUTER and DIAL-UP MODEM that can work with Nigerian ISP's (like MTN, AIRTEL e.t.c) that i can purchase. I am in Ebonyi state and there is no good service provider here except the usual GSM operators we have in Nigeria.

a rough sketch of what i need is below. Thanks for your contributions.

Re: HELP Needed With Setting Up A Home Network by GlorifiedTunde(m): 12:29am On Aug 08, 2016
Get any D-link Gigabit Ethernet Wireless Router. 802.1g/b/n

Modem would depend on the strong networks in you area.

But Glo 15k - about 6 users
Etisalat 15k - about 10 users

You're also gonna need to buy specifically cat5e or Cat6 network cable for your wired connection.
